Comprehending the Swedish Driver's Permit System
The Swedish motorist's license, known locally as "körkort," is an official file provided by the Swedish Transport Administration (Transportstyrelsen) that authorizes individuals to run motor lorries on public roads. Sweden acknowledges numerous classifications of motorist's authorizations, varying from licenses for mopeds and motorcycles to authorizations for automobile and heavy vehicles. The most frequently sought license is the B-category authorization, which enables holders to drive automobile weighing approximately 3,500 kgs.
Swedish driving guidelines are significantly strict, reflecting the nation's dedication to road security. The Swedish system highlights extensive driver education, requiring both theoretical knowledge and practical driving skills before providing a complete license.
The Step-by-Step Process for Obtaining Your Permit
The journey toward getting a Swedish motorist's license follows a structured course that guarantees all motorists satisfy minimum competency requirements. Comprehending each phase assists candidates plan their time and budget plan successfully while avoiding unnecessary hold-ups.
The very first stage involves eligibility verification and preliminary requirements. Candidates need to have a legitimate recognition document, generally a Swedish personal identification number (personnummer) or a coordination number for newly shown up locals. Those without Swedish citizenship must show lawful residency through residence permits or other documentation. A medical exam becomes obligatory for applicants over 45 years of age, guaranteeing physical conditioning to operate cars securely.
The second stage focuses on motorist education, which in Sweden is comprehensive and mandatory. This education makes up three compulsory parts: theory education covering traffic guidelines, safety procedures, and environmental considerations; danger training resolving harmful situations such as driving under adverse conditions and acknowledging dangers; and practical driving lessons with licensed instructors. The number of needed driving lessons differs based upon individual skill advancement, however a lot of candidates complete in between 15 and 25 hours of useful training.
The third stage entails passing the two-part driving examination. The theory test, conducted electronically at main screening centers, assesses understanding of traffic guidelines, road indications, and safe driving practices. This computer-based evaluation includes 65 questions, and candidates should attain a minimum rating to pass. Following successful completion of the theory test, candidates proceed to the practical driving test, which evaluates real car operation skills carried out by licensed inspectors on public roads.
Complete Cost Breakdown
Comprehending the monetary investment required for obtaining a Swedish driver's permit assists applicants budget plan appropriately and avoid unrealistic expectations. Expenses differ considerably based on specific knowing pace, the driving school picked, and geographic place within Sweden.
| Expense Category | Estimated Price (SEK) |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Application Fee (Transportstyrelsen) | 250 | Required for processing the authorization |
| Theory Test Fee | 325 | First effort; retakes expense additional charges |
| Practical Driving Test Fee | 800 | First attempt; retakes require extra payment |
| Necessary Risk Training | 1,500-2,000 | Two-course minimum requirement |
| Driving Lessons (per hour) | 500-700 | Differs by trainer and region |
| Student Permit Fee | 220 | Required throughout discovering duration |
| Eye Examination | 100-200 | Needed before theory test |
| First Aid Certificate | 300-500 | Often consisted of in driving school packages |
When aggregating these expenses, most applicants invest between 8,000 and 15,000 Swedish kronor for the total procedure, though expenses can exceed 20,000 kronor for those requiring extra driving lessons or evaluation retries. Numerous Swedish driving schools offer bundle offers that supply expense savings compared to spending for specific elements separately.
Frequently Asked Questions
How long does the whole process take from start to finish?
The timeline differs substantially based on private situations and dedication level. For dedicated learners who progress progressively through education requirements, the procedure usually spans three to six months. Factors that extend the timeline include limited accessibility for driving lessons, needed evaluation retakes, and scheduling restraints at testing centers. Applicants must plan for prospective hold-ups and prevent hurrying through necessary training phases.
Can I use my foreign driver's license in Sweden?
Locals of EU/EEA nations can use their legitimate driver's licenses in Sweden indefinitely. However, if you end up being an irreversible resident, exchanging your license for a Swedish equivalent is suggested and often needed for insurance coverage functions. For licenses from nations outside the EU/EEA, validity periods differ, and numerous such licenses need Swedish confirmation or replacement after a certain duration of residency. International driving licenses enhance but do not replace the requirement for appropriate paperwork.
What takes place if I stop working the driving test?
Failed assessments are typical and do not represent irreversible obstacles. Candidates may retake both the theory and dry runs after a mandatory waiting period of usually 2 weeks for the practical test. Each retake requires payment of the particular evaluation cost again. Statistics indicate that first-time pass rates hover around 50-60%, highlighting the significance of extensive preparation.
Is it possible to speed up the procedure by paying extra fees?
The Swedish Transport Administration maintains standardized processing times regardless of payment. While premium services do not exist for expedited evaluation scheduling, picking an effective driving school with offered lesson times can speed up development. Nevertheless, attempting to hurry through required training normally results in examination failures, ultimately triggering hold-ups and additional expenses.
